The Vietnamese word "bột khởi" is a noun that refers to a sudden, intense uprising or surge, often used in the context of social movements or public protests. It can describe a situation where a group of people rises up together with strong emotions, typically in response to some form of injustice or dissatisfaction.
In advanced discussions, "bột khởi" can be used in a metaphorical sense to describe any sudden increase in activity or intensity, not just in a political context. For example: - "Bột khởi trong ngành công nghệ đã tạo ra nhiều sản phẩm đổi mới." (The surge in the tech industry has created many innovative products.)
While "bột khởi" primarily refers to a social uprising, it can also imply any sudden and intense action or reaction in various contexts. However, it is most commonly associated with collective movements.
